How are the elements on the periodic arranged? Responses A by number of protonsby number of protons B by atomic massby atomic mass C by number of neutronsby number of neutrons D by number of electrons

Answers

The elements on the Periodic are arranged by atomic number which is equivalent to the number of protons in the nucleus of an atom.

The hemoglobin of sickle cell anemia: A. is oxygen rich
B. differs from the normal protein by one amino acid
C. can carry less oxygen and more carbon dioxide
D. is normal

Answers

The hemoglobin of sickle cell anemia differs from the normal protein by one amino acid i.e., glutamic acid is replaced by valine.

What is sickle cell anemia?

  • Sickle cell disease is a blood ailment that is passed down through the generations.
  • It effects the hemoglobin, this is the protein in red blood cells that transports oxygen to the body's tissues.
  • As a result, sickle cell disease prevents oxygen from reaching the tissues.
  • Normal hemoglobin-containing red blood cells are smooth, disk-shaped, and flexible, like doughnuts without holes.

How is sickle cell anemia caused?

  • A mutation in the hemoglobin- gene on chromosome 11 causes sickle cell disease.
  • Hemoglobin is a protein that carries oxygen from the lungs to the rest of the body.
  • Normal hemoglobin (hemoglobin-A) red blood cells are smooth and spherical, and they glide through blood arteries.
  • It is produced by a point mutation in the B-chain of hemoglobin, where glutamic acid is replaced by valine at position 6.

Which answer lists the levels of the biosphere from smallest to largest, left to right?a. individual—population—biome—community—ecosystem


b. ecosystem—biome—community—population—individual


c. individual—population—community—ecosystem—biome


d. ecosystem—individual—population—biome—community

Answers

Answer: c. individual—population—community—ecosystem—biome

Explanation:

Biosphere is a part of earth which includes the living beings like plants and animals interact with the other important spheres of the earth like atmosphere, lithosphere, and hydrosphere to lead a healthy life.

c. individual—population—community—ecosystem—biome  is the correct sequence that lists the levels of the biosphere from smallest to the largest.

The individual represent a single organism of any species, the population includes individuals of a single species, the community includes members of two or more species living together, the ecosystem involves one or more biotic communities which interact with their non-living physical environment.
